We are looking for a highly motivated and self-driven Clinical Coordinator who is passionate about providing exceptional care to join our leadership team. This role is a blend of actively engaging at the coal face, as well as reviewing clinical documentation, systems and analysing trends. Reporting to the Clinical Manager, you will actively lead and mentor staff ensuring teams are equipped and supported to deliver the best resident-focused care within the Aged Care Quality framework. What can you expect to be doing? Provide clinical leadership, support, mentoring and education to the clinical and care teams Provide clinical guidance to ensure a consistent team approach Ensure the clinical audit schedule is undertaken in a timely manner Promote and support resident and family participation in decisions Identify and implement continuous improvement activities Liaise with Allied Health, Medical Practitioners and other members of the care team Support and mentor new and existing care staff What do you need to bring? Bachelor of Nursing or equivalent, and current registration with AHPRA as a Registered Nurse Extensive clinical experience as a Registered Nurse or Clinical Nurse within Residential Aged Care Previous leadership experience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ills High level of computer literacy How to Apply: If this sounds like you please click on Apply and submit your application - all you need is your resume!
